TVET Colleges are institutions that focus on vocational and occupational education and training. In simple terms, they teach you practical skills that can get you into the workplace fast. This includes fields like engineering, business, IT, hospitality, education, and even agriculture.

South Africa currently has 50 public TVET colleges, with campuses across all nine provinces, and many of them open their doors multiple times a year — including for Trimester 3.
Here’s something a lot of people don’t realise: not all TVET courses start at the beginning of the year.
In fact, for some of the most in-demand programmes — like Engineering Studies — colleges follow a trimester system. This means they take in new students three times a year:
Trimester 1: January
Trimester 2: May
Trimester 3: September
So, if you missed the earlier intakes, Trimester 3 is your chance to jump in without waiting for 2026. It’s perfect for anyone who is ready to get started now.
